It is an immersive experience for listeners to imagine the characters and the story through dialogue, music and sound effects. What is Radio Theatre? Radio Theatre is the bridge between film and audio books in the format of a dramatized, purely acoustic performance. Fully dramatized and produced with cinema-quality sound design and music, The Horse and His Boy is the third of seven audio dramas in the Focus on the Family Radio Theatre production of The Chronicles of Narnia. Featuring talented voice actors, film-style sound design, and a rich musical score, this is an adventure on an epic scale. As they travel across deserts, through cities, and over mountains, a mysterious lion shadows their every move and a treacherous prince wages war against an unsuspecting Narnia.
